Triton 650 Dresda.
Wideline 1959 Norton Featherbed frame with uprated square section Dresda Swinging arm. Polished alloy petrol tank and oil tank, the tank has “Norton” decals. Pre unit 650cc 6T engine and Triumph gearbox.
I have the gear change pointing backwards but included in the sale is the rear-set to return the gearbox to standard 1 down. The gear change is smooth and positive using the clutch or not. I have fitted a cranked kick start so that it doesn’t catch my shin when riding. Engine has a twin carb head and starts easily once you have flooded both cylinders and resist the temptation to open the throttle. Magneto works perfectly and it is on 12v -ve earth. All the instruments are working and I have fitted a handlebar mirror for my own peace of mind. There are a few tools and spare bits and pieces included , clutch locking tool in particular. Tyres have no wear on them and both brakes are effective.
